Except for being cropped slightly and then reduced in size in order to upload it into FA's gallery, this picture of a Douglas A-26 Invader on static display at yesterday's Carson City Airport Open House is presented exactly as it came out of the camera. N126HK, "Keck In The Ass," was one of three "centerpiece" displays along with an OV-10 Bronco and a Cobra helicopter. "Tootsie," the B-25 in the background of this shot, drew her fair share of admirers, too.

Constructed as an A-26C-50-DT by Douglas at Tulsa, Oklahoma, USA. 1948 Redesignated as B-26C.
6 September 1952 Unstated accident at Kahului Airport, Maui, HI.From 1987 to 1994.
Restored at Troy, AL, delivered to Oshkosh 1994.1982 to 2000 To EAA Aviation Foundation Inc, Oshkosh, WI. 2014 To Cactus Air Force Wings and Wheels Museum, Carson City, NV.
N126HK (1944 DOUGLAS A-26C owned by CACTUS AIR FORCE WINGS & WHEELS MUSEUM)
